So, what makes spa grooming different from a standard bath? Imagine your dog enjoying a soothing oatmeal bath to calm itchy skin from our pollen-heavy springs, followed by a deep-conditioning treatment to restore moisture stripped away by our summer heat. A skilled groomer will perform a meticulous de-shedding treatment, a lifesaver for breeds prone to thick coats, especially as the Georgia seasons change. The experience often includes paw-dicures with moisturizing balm to protect pads from hot pavement and rough terrain, and a gentle blueberry facial to brighten the coat around the eyes.

It’s a personalized service you just can’t get from a DIY hose-down in the backyard. Regular spa sessions also become a crucial health check. Your groomer becomes a second set of eyes, often spotting early signs of issues like ear infections, skin irritations, or unusual lumps you might miss.
Integrating spa grooming into your pet care routine is simpler than you think. Start by finding a local groomer who emphasizes a calm, fear-free environment—ask your neighbors at the Piggly Wiggly or your vet for recommendations. For active dogs who love our outdoors, consider a spa day every 6-8 weeks to manage coat health and hygiene. In between appointments, maintain that spa-fresh feeling with quick paw wipes after adventures and regular brushing at home.
